Health Condition 1: N393- Stress incontinence (female) (male)
Conditions
Interventions
Intervention1: Treatment arm: Pelvic floor muscle exercise and anti cholinergic medication are to be given for a period of 6 week and then outcome assessement along with electrostimulation of pelvic f

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Female Patients presenting with clinically diagnosed Stress and stress predominant mixed Urinary Incontinence
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Age less than 30 yr and more than 60 yrs femalw patient
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| 1. Number of women with self-reported continence (no urinary incontinence, as reported by women), dry pad test and Improved quality of life on ICIQ-UI_SF Questionarre 2.Satisfaction with treatment Quantification of symptoms (e.g. number of incontinence episodes (every 24 hours), number of micturitions every 24 hours will be assessed by 3 days bladder diary, ICIQ-UI-SF, Pad tests,stress cough test Timepoint: Outcomes will be assessed at baseline,6 week, and at 3 month | — |
